In which situation is peer pressure harder to resist because of the need for a quick decisic

A friend invites someone to a party a few days away.
A student asks her partner to cheat during a test.
A girlfriend wants her boyfriend to go to the same college.
A person tells a friend they should try out for the play next month.​

Answer:

A student asks her partner to cheat during a test, as it is happening in the moment. With all of the other situations, they have time to consider their options.
